Soccer, known as the world’s most popular sport, requires specific gear to ensure safety and enhance performance. Whether you’re a beginner or a seasoned player, understanding the essential soccer gear can improve your game and enjoyment.
What Are the Essential Gear Items for Soccer?
To play soccer effectively, players need a few key pieces of equipment. The basic soccer gear includes a ball, cleats, shin guards, and a uniform. Each piece serves a specific purpose, contributing to both safety and performance on the field.
Why Are Soccer Cleats Important?
Soccer cleats are crucial for providing traction and stability on the field. They are designed with studs or spikes on the sole to prevent slipping. Cleats come in various styles, suited for different playing surfaces:
- Firm Ground (FG): Ideal for natural grass fields.
- Soft Ground (SG): Used on wet or muddy fields.
- Artificial Ground (AG): Designed for synthetic turf surfaces.
Wearing the right type of cleats enhances your agility and speed, allowing for better control and maneuverability.
How Do Shin Guards Protect Players?
Shin guards are essential for protecting the lower legs from impacts and injuries. They are typically made from materials like plastic or carbon fiber and are worn under the socks. Shin guards come in different styles, including:
- Slip-in: Lightweight and easy to wear.
- Ankle: Provides additional protection around the ankle area.
Using shin guards reduces the risk of fractures and bruises, ensuring a safer playing experience.
What Should You Know About Soccer Balls?
The soccer ball is the centerpiece of the game. It is typically made of leather or synthetic materials and is available in different sizes:
- Size 3: For players under 8 years old.
- Size 4: For players aged 8 to 12.
- Size 5: Standard size for players over 12 and adults.
Choosing the correct ball size is crucial for skill development and game enjoyment. A properly inflated ball ensures accurate passes and shots.
Why Is a Soccer Uniform Necessary?
A soccer uniform consists of a jersey, shorts, and socks. These items are typically made from breathable materials to keep players cool and comfortable. Uniforms often include team colors and logos, fostering team spirit and unity.
Additional Soccer Gear for Goalkeepers
Goalkeepers require specialized gear to perform effectively and safely. This includes:
- Goalkeeper Gloves: Provide grip and protection for the hands.
- Padded Jerseys and Shorts: Offer extra cushioning to absorb impact during dives and saves.

What is the Best Material for Soccer Cleats?
Leather and synthetic materials are both popular for soccer cleats. Leather offers a comfortable fit and good ball control, while synthetic materials are lightweight and durable.
How Often Should You Replace Soccer Gear?
Soccer gear should be replaced as soon as it shows signs of wear and tear. Cleats typically last one season, while shin guards and uniforms can last longer with proper care.
Do All Players Need Goalkeeper Gloves?
No, only goalkeepers need specialized gloves. Field players do not require gloves, as they primarily use their feet during the game.
What Are the Benefits of Wearing a Soccer Uniform?
Wearing a uniform promotes team unity and ensures players meet the league’s dress code. It also helps players stay comfortable and focused during the game.
How Can I Maintain My Soccer Gear?
Regularly clean and inspect your gear for damage. Store cleats and balls in a dry place to prevent mold and mildew. Wash uniforms according to care instructions to maintain their quality.
